Software Engineer (Frontend)

Job Description

Posted on: 
February 10, 2022

As an engineer in the frontend team, you will be in charge of our webapp currently serving thousands of daily active users, building new features and iterating on existing ones. You will also be working very closely with the founding team and will have the opportunity to get your hands dirty in building a company from scratch.

🌌 What we are offering

  • An environment with a large degree of autonomy
  • Freedom to experiment with different cutting-edge technologies to solve problems
  • Ownership of the features, where your views and opinions will be heard
  • An opportunity to drive a huge impact on a fast-growing company


  • Maintain, improve and build upon the current feature set of the webapp
  • Develop mobile responsive components and reuseable libraries
  • Liaise and collaborate with developers of other protocols within Terra
  • Analyse product requirements and translate them into clean and elegant code
  • Work closely with the web backend and business teams to meet requirements

Job Requirements

  • Strong coding proficiency in TypeScript and a suitable frontend framework like React/Vue/Svelte
  • Experience working with common build/dev tools like tailwind, yarn, webpack, rollup, vite, etc.
  • Familiar with both REST and GraphQL APIs
  • Working understanding of software security fundamentals and cryptography practices
  • Tenacity to learn and adapt quickly in an ever-changing field
  • Keen interest in building within the Web3 or DeFi space (preferred, not required)
  • Fresh graduates with a passion for frontend technology and UI design and development, and a solid understanding of how modern apps are built are welcome to apply

Apply nowApply now

More job openings